Nigerian Bar Association Women Forum will hold an online innovative lunchtime mentoring session.

According to the statement from the NBAWF Mentorship Committee made available to TheNigerialawyer the virtual mentoring session which is scheduled to hold tomorrow,  will be led by Senior Advocates of Nigeria, Mia Essien, SAN, Abimbola Akeredolu, SAN and Prof Toyin Akintola.

The time is  1pm – 2:30pm, 1st April, 2020.

The Main Topics to be discussed are:
1. Professional Development

2. Managing Practice in a Coronavirus Environment; and

3. Understanding Mentoring

Sub-Topics as time will permit will be:
Self Development,
Advocacy Skills, Dealing with Sexual Harassment in the Workplace, Work-life Balance, Choice of Life Partner.
